Transaction 76590c20d3af38a4e35da553a6d536ed472ca0752229cae2288abfe7d5be7745
1 Input
1 Output
-
76590c20d3af38a4e35da553a6d536ed472ca0752229cae2288abfe7d5be7745:0
- value
- 300880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aaea258b4a0f9a68a4be47d7568aa346fd4c250a OP_EQUAL
- address
- 3HGjHx3WiM4QBhA4praNETzcYELC16T89u